Overall purpose
To support children (the child/ren who have complex medical needs and/or their siblings) in 1:1 sessions through the integration of counselling and play skills

For students: Please check whether your course placement requirements would enable you to provide counselling at external venues (clients home, hospitals, hospices etc). This would occur only after a settling in period and with additional training and support provided by The Maypole Project.
Support
Whilst volunteering you will have support from our Family Support Co-ordinator for day to day issues and our Lead Therapist or another qualified counsellor for monthly clinical supervision.
Location
At our offices in Orpington and Greenwich or, after a settling-in period, in local schools, hospitals, hospices and client’s homes.
Time Commitment
Volunteers days and hours are negotiable but, due to the long-term promise of support to our clients, a most valued aspect of our service, we do ask volunteer applicants to be available to volunteer for a minimum of 6 months from acceptance onto the volunteering programme at The Maypole Project. We would ideally like volunteers to aspire to offering 2 years commitment to the role.
